Defining Catastrophic Injuries and Their Impact

Catastrophic injuries are severe physical injuries that result in significant and lasting impairments. They may include traumatic brain injuries, spinal cord injuries, amputations, severe burns, or paralysis. These injuries often require ongoing medical treatment, rehabilitation, and may limit a person’s ability to work or perform daily activities. Understanding the nature and consequences of such injuries is essential when seeking legal recourse.

Essential Terms in Catastrophic Injury Cases

Understanding common legal terms can help clients navigate the complexities of catastrophic injury cases. Below are definitions of frequently used terms within personal injury law related to severe injuries.

Liability

Liability refers to the legal responsibility one party has for causing injury or damages to another. In catastrophic injury cases, proving liability is fundamental to securing compensation from the party at fault.

Damages

Damages are monetary compensation awarded to an injured person for losses suffered due to another’s negligence or wrongful act. This may include medical expenses, lost income, pain and suffering, and future care costs.

Negligence

Negligence is the failure to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to another person. Establishing negligence is a key element in many catastrophic injury claims.

Settlement

A settlement is an agreement reached between parties to resolve a legal dispute without going to trial. Settlements in catastrophic injury cases often involve compensation paid by the liable party to the injured individual.

What qualifies as a catastrophic injury in California?

A catastrophic injury in California refers to a severe physical injury that results in long-term or permanent disability, significant impairment, or substantial loss of function. Examples include traumatic brain injuries, spinal cord injuries, amputations, and severe burns. These injuries often require extensive medical treatment and rehabilitation. Understanding whether an injury qualifies as catastrophic is important because it influences the legal approach and potential compensation. Each case is unique and requires detailed evaluation to determine the extent and impact of the injury.

In California, the statute of limitations for filing a personal injury claim, including catastrophic injury cases, is generally two years from the date of the injury. It is important to act promptly to preserve your legal rights and to ensure evidence and witness testimony remain available. Delays in filing can result in the loss of your ability to recover compensation. Consulting a legal professional early helps ensure deadlines are met and your case is handled effectively.

Mediation is often used as a step before trial to facilitate settlement discussions in a less formal setting. It provides an opportunity for parties to negotiate with the help of a neutral mediator and potentially avoid the time and cost of a trial. Whether your case goes to mediation depends on the circumstances and the strategies employed by your legal team and opposing parties.

Important evidence in catastrophic injury claims includes medical records, accident reports, witness statements, expert testimony, and documentation of expenses and lost income. Photographs and videos of the injury and accident scene can also be valuable. Collecting and preserving this evidence helps establish liability and the extent of damages, forming the foundation of a strong legal case to seek compensation.
